Brought my car in to the dealership yesterday and showed them the TSB. The chirping has been documented in previous services so there wasn't much dispute on their end. They said they would order the part Monday and it would take about a week to get. In the meantime I'm sitting with a Airaid intake still in the box. I hope the new Fuel Pump fixes the issue. I've heard of people getting their ECU's re-flashed to fix this issue as well. Can anyone chime in? Should I ask my dealer to do this?
